Leetcode 111. 二叉树的最小深度

111. 二叉树的最小深度

还是层序遍历

class Solution {
    public int minDepth(TreeNode root) {
        if (root == null)
            return 0;
        
        Queue queue = new LinkedList<>();
        queue.offer(root);
        int depth = 1;
        while(!queue.isEmpty()){
            int size = queue.size();
            for(int i=0;i

最后return个啥都行,在循环中一定可以找到叶子。

你可能感兴趣的:(LeetCode,leetcode,算法,java)